Maximizing Your Police Officer Earnings in Estero

Compensation variations among experienced police officers in Estero can be pronounced based on job specialization and the type of employer. Specialized roles in areas like narcotics, cybercrime, and SWAT can attract premium pay that elevates compensation above standard rates. Moreover, compensation structures can differ dramatically based on whether an officer is employed by city police departments, county sheriff's offices, or federal agencies, with federal positions generally offering higher salaries compared to municipal roles. Career advancement is often accessed through a clear trajectory, progressing from patrol officer to detective or specialized unit leader; advanced educational credentials and certifications can enhance earning capacity, as many agencies offer incentives for higher education and specialized training. Additionally, factors like union contracts and overtime opportunities play a significant role in overall compensation, impacting the total financial package for seasoned officers and fostering a competitive environment for top-tier positions.
